What Is an Abdominoplasty?
An abdominoplasty, additionally called tummy tuck, is an operation designed to remove excess skin and fat from your abdominal location, while also tightening the underlying muscles. A stomach tuck may be what you need if you've struggled with loose skin or persistent fat after weight maternity, aging, or loss. The treatment can boost your body shape, bring about a flatter and even more toned appearance.
It's essential to recognize that a tummy tuck is not a weight-loss solution. Consulting with a certified surgeon can aid you evaluate the benefits against the risks, ensuring you make a notified choice.

The Various Kinds of Stomach Tucks
When considering an abdominoplasty, it is very important to understand that there are numerous kinds made to resolve different demands and preferences. The complete abdominoplasty, or tummy tuck, entails a bigger incision and gets rid of excess skin and fat from the whole abdominal area. A tiny stomach put may be the right choice if you're mainly worried regarding the area listed below your stomach switch. This alternative calls for a smaller sized incision and concentrates on the lower abdomen.
For those that have actually had multiple maternities or considerable weight-loss, a circumferential belly put can provide a much more complete solution by lifting the abdominal area, buttocks, and upper legs. Ultimately, if you're looking for subtle changes, a non-surgical stomach tuck may be an alternative, making use of methods like liposuction or skin tightening. Understanding these alternatives can aid you select the finest approach for your body and objectives.

Surgical Threats Entailed
While an abdominoplasty can boost your body contour, it's crucial to be knowledgeable about the surgical risks entailed. Problems can occur during or after the procedure, consisting of infection, bleeding, and anesthesia-related issues. You might experience adverse responses to drugs or blood embolisms, which can be severe. There's additionally the possibility of inadequate wound recovery, causing scars that might not fade as wanted. Fluid buildup under the skin, understood as seroma, can happen and may require drainage. Additionally, some people report discontentment with their results, which can bring about further procedures. Comprehending these risks is essential in making a notified decision regarding your tummy tuck and ensuring you're gotten ready for the journey ahead.

Recuperation Refine After an Abdominoplasty
As you begin your recuperation after an abdominoplasty, it's crucial to understand what to anticipate throughout this healing process. At first, you'll experience swelling, wounding, and discomfort, which is regular. Your cosmetic surgeon will give particular guidelines on discomfort monitoring, including medicines to help ease any kind of pain.
For the very first couple of days, you'll require to relax and prevent strenuous tasks. It's critical to keep your cuts clean and completely dry to stop infection. You'll likely use a compression garment to support your abdominal area and lower swelling.
Follow-up consultations are essential to guarantee appropriate recovery. The majority of individuals can return to work in about two to 4 weeks, however complete recovery may take a number of months.

For how long Does an Abdominoplasty Treatment Normally Take?
A stomach tuck procedure generally takes regarding two to 5 hours, relying on the complexity. You'll intend to prepare for a healing duration afterward, which can considerably influence your total timeline and recovery procedure.
Will a Belly Put Impact My Capability to Get Expectant?
An abdominoplasty will not directly influence your ability to obtain pregnant, yet it can change your stomach muscles and skin. If maternity is in your future plans, take into consideration talking about timing with your doctor in advance.
Can I Integrate an Abdominoplasty With Various Other Surgical Treatments?
Yes, you can combine a tummy put with various other surgeries, like lipo or boob job. However, reviewing your details objectives and health with your specialist's vital to assure safety and security and perfect outcomes.
What Is the Price Range for a Belly Tuck?
A tummy tuck typically costs between $6,000 and $12,000. Variables like your area, specialist's experience, and details procedure details can affect the last cost. Always talk to your cosmetic surgeon for an accurate quote.
Are Abdominoplasty Results Permanent?
Tummy tuck outcomes can be resilient, but they aren't entirely irreversible. If you gain or shed substantial weight, or experience pregnancy, your outcomes could alter. Keeping a secure weight helps maintain your makeover.
